Paris Saint-Germain Football Club, or simply PSG is a professional football club based in Paris, France. They compete in Ligue 1, the top division of French football. As France’s most successful club, they have won over 40 official honors, including ten league titles and one major European trophy. Their home ground is the Parc des Princes.

The Parisians were founded in 1970, following the merger of Paris FC and Stade Saint-Germain. PSG won their first major honor, the French Cup, in 1982 and their first Division 1 title in 1986. Currently, PSG’s strong financial position has been sustained by the club’s Qatari owners; the team’s on-pitch success; high-profile signings, including Zlatan Ibrahimović, Neymar, Kylian Mbappé and Lionel Messi; and lucrative sponsorship deals with the Qatar Tourism Authority, Nike, Air Jordan, Accor and Qatar Airways.

Nasser Al-Khelaïfi is Chairman and CEO of Paris Saint-Germain.When Qatar Sports Investments (QSI) acquired PSG in 2011, Nasser Al-Khelaifi was named the club’s 17th president. Under Al-Khelaifi’s leadership, a clear strategic plan was established to develop the club into a major player on the European and international football stage, while being a force for good off-the-pitch.

Over the subsequent few years, PSG was propelled to the top of men’s football, both in France and in Europe, winning 8 out of 10 domestic league titles and, in August 2020, reaching the final of the men’s UEFA Champions League for the first time in the club’s 50-year history.
